Bristol City vs Man City highlights and reaction as Foden and De Bruyne send Blues through
Manchester City have progressed to the quarter finals of the FA Cup thanks to a comfortable win over Bristol City.
Kalvin Phillips nearly gave City the perfect start when his long range shot clipped the crossbar. However, the Blues only had to wait until the 7th minute to have the lead.
Riyad Mahrez played a through ball to Kevin De Bruyne. The Belgian's drilled cross was turned in at the back post by Phil Foden.
The Robins have had chances with Alex Scott proving to be their biggest threat and they continued to threaten after the break. Sam Bell had their best chance but he could not direct his header goalward.
Bell's miss came back to bite them as City had their second. Good vision by Julian Alvarez picked out Foden whose strike went in via a deflection.
De Bruyne added gloss to the result with a fine strike seven minutes later. City will now have to wait to find out their next quarter final opponents.
